> After Hagrid puts Harry on the train back to the Dursley's after
> their shopping trip, Harry blinks and Hagrid is gone. The only
> explanation seems to be apparition, but it does not fit with Hagrid
> who never completed his education, and is not that good at magic. How
> could he be doing something that is said to be very advanced magic,
> with which many fully qualified wizards do not bother?
Eloise:
Sudden disappearance is a characteristic of many (all?) the odd people Harry
meets before he knows he is a wizard and whom we understand in retrospect to
be members of the WW. I wonder if all of them apparate?
I have wondered if in fact there are other ways for wizard folk to make
themselves inconspicuous, much in the way a Muggle magician might use some
kind of distraction technique to draw attention away from what he is doing,
only in this case utilising 'real' magic.
I agree that it seems unlikely, though not impossible, that Hagrid could
apparate (I wonder if he would be *allowed* to take the test?), but the
sudden disappearance of one so large takes some explaining.

> The other is a seeming discrepancy between SS and GoF. In SS is
> clearly says that Mrs. Figg's house smelled of cabbage. In GoF
> however, when they enter the tents Harry notes that the furnishing
> was similar to that of Mrs. Figg, but without the smell of cats. A
> mistake?
Eloise:
Perhaps the tent smells of cabbages too? (In order to give it that real
Muggle flavour, in case anyone from the site management looks in.)
Newer members of the list may have missed posts that pointed out that cabbage
smells are associated with Polyjuice Potion, leading to all sorts of
theorising about Mrs Figg and her true identity/appearance.
